Key Considerations Before Buying
- Collapsibility vs. durability: The silicone construction must withstand repeated folding without developing permanent creases or weak spots that could lead to leaks, especially at the seam where the cap attaches.
- Flow rate and drinking valve: For running or cycling, the ease of one-handed operation and flow control during motion is critical—some soft flasks struggle with backpressure when nearly empty.
- Cleaning and drying maintenance: The narrow opening and collapsible nature can trap moisture and odors if not properly dried, requiring specific attention compared to wide-mouth bottles.

Common Issues
Typical failures include leaky caps after repeated twisting, difficulty fully drying the interior leading to mildew, and bite valves that freeze in cold weather or leak under pack pressure. Some flasks also develop a permanent collapsed fold, reducing their effective capacity over time.
Quality Indicators
High-quality soft flasks use food-grade silicone with uniform thickness, have reinforced seams at stress points, and feature caps with reliable O-ring seals. The best integrate a rigid collar around the opening to prevent collapse while drinking and enable easier filling from narrow streams.
